Title: Kenneth J. Cleereman: A Pioneer in Thermoplastic Forming Innovations

Introduction

Kenneth J. Cleereman, an accomplished inventor based in Midland, MI, has made significant strides in the field of thermoplastic forming technologies. With a remarkable portfolio consisting of 8 patents, Cleereman’s innovations have paved the way for more efficient and environmentally friendly manufacturing processes in the plastics industry.

Latest Patents

Cleereman's latest patents demonstrate his commitment to advancing thermoplastic processing techniques. His notable inventions include:

1. **Method of forming blanks for the solid-phase forming of thermoplastic** - This innovative process allows for the fabrication of thermoplastic articles directly from resinous powder without generating waste. The technique involves several steps: briquetting the resinous powder, sintering the briquette, and then repressing and shaping it into a preform or blank suitable for thermoforming. This method is particularly beneficial for manufacturing large parts from thermoplastic materials.

2. **Scrapless forming of plastic articles** - In this process, Cleereman presents a method that utilizes a scrap-free, substantially solid-phase technique to create economical plastic articles from resinous powders. By compressing the resinous powders into briquettes and heating them to just below their melting point, these briquettes can be forged into preforms, which may then be thermoformed into various shapes. This process offers versatility, allowing for the production of diverse polymers and blended structures while minimizing waste.

Career Highlights

Cleereman's work is primarily associated with The Dow Chemical Company, a renowned leader in the chemical industry. His innovative contributions have not only enhanced the company’s capabilities but have also left a lasting impact on the plastics manufacturing sector.

Collaborations

Throughout his career, Kenneth has collaborated with esteemed colleagues such as Walter J. Schrenk and Ralph E. Ayres. Together, they have synergized their expertise, contributing to the development of groundbreaking solutions in thermoplastic processing.
